Get started6 Moss Lane is a mid-terrace house in Birkenhead (CH42 9LB). It has a recorded floor area of 95 m² (around 1023 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1900-1929 and council tax band A. The latest certificate (May 2013) shows a D (score 58), a step below the typical UK home.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 83), a 2-band jump. Main heating runs on electricity. The latest certificate is from May 2013, so improvements made since then won't be reflected.
Today's modelled estimate of £137,000 is 44.2% above the 2022 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£93/sq ft) was about 20.1% below the postcode norm. Sold November 2022 for £95,000. That sale was during the post-pandemic price surge, when transactions cleared materially above pre-2020 trend.
